Cacophobia is considered a real phobia, specifically the irrational fear of ugliness or anything perceived as ugly. It falls under the umbrella of specific phobias, where individuals experience intense anxiety or distress when confronted with things they deem unattractive. While it can involve subjective judgments about beauty and aesthetics, the fear itself is a psychological condition that can impact a person's daily life.
